multiple connection
If you don't want to modify sources of icecast which is non trivial I would have recommended writing a script that fetches list of clients periodically over icecast admin API and kills these that utilize too many connections. If they would have keep reconnecting you should implement more advanced solution - with total blocking on firewall or within icecast. If you need further support,
